Summary:
The Buyer will be responsible for procuring & monitoring the movement of materials to meet production this role the incumbent will also obtain materials using engineering & production schedules to maintain inventory at planned levels. Ensures material standards are met and non-conformances or variances are resolved. Monitors cost schedule and scope of assigned subcontracts to assure best quality at best value.
Core Responsibilities:
To perform the job successfully an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ily.
Assist in developing annual sourcing goals & put steps in place to achieve them (new supplier qualification RFQs renegotiations suggest potential engineering redesigns for cost savings internal company spending review credit card holders review etc.).
Set-up in internal & external Kanban program & educate newer suppliers on the Kanban program & set-up. Daily Kanban management.
Manage daily New Buy Late & Kanban reports for actions needed. Create & manage supplier VMI contracts by creating ceasing or modifying Agreements as needed.
Facilitate supplier meetings with Inspector & Engineers as needed regarding quality issues to find resolution.
Work with client Global Procurement Management Team on various cost savings & supplier projects. Conduct in indirect/purchase requisition ordering.
Assist in researching & communicate ECO cost impacts to internal departments. Assist in ECO supplier notifications & PO updates. Perform Oracle New Part Set-up & Maintenance.
Conduct Kaizen/continuous events & implement procurement department-related improvement processes. Work toward goal of achieving of 98% incoming inspection quality passing rates.
Work toward goal of achieving of 95% OTD from suppliers. Assist in monthly department safety audits & reports findings. Participate in War Room spend audits review & make cost spend recommendations/changes where needed.
Assist in reconciling any Receiving Incoming Inspection or Accounts Payable issues as needed to properly receive return &/or pay for goods.
Assist in as needed inventory audits. Assist in running reports for Supplier Scorecards issue Corrective Action Plans & regularly audit Supplier performance including site visits & report reviews.
Participates in internal employee committee to assist with sources best venues material costs & services. Assist in Reconciling month-end reports.
Reconcile p-card monthly with Concur.
